This next window configures the way your system will dial the selected
access number.
If you normally need to dial a digit to get an outside line, put a
check next to "To access an outside
line, Dial:" and then enter the digit in the appropriate text
box.
If you have call waiting and want to disable it while you're connected
to the internet, put a check next to "To
disable Call Waiting, Dial:" and choose the appropriate key sequence
in the drop down list.
If you need to dial the area code for all local numbers put a check
next to "Use 10-Digit Dialing".
Put a check next to "Use Pulse Dialing"
if your phone service does not use tones to dial.
As you select the various options the exact number your computer will
dial will be displayed at the bottom of the window.
Click "Next >" to continue.
